Fine-Tuning Product Regimens for Warmer Days


One of the most effective ways to refresh a skincare protocol is by rethinking the products your clients use daily. As temperatures rise, hefty occlusive items might no longer serve them well. Consider recommending lighter hydration and switching from abundant creams to gel-based or water-based choices.


Cleansing is one more crucial area where subtle changes can make a significant distinction. In the springtime, the skin may produce even more oil and sweat, specifically with boosted activity and time outdoors. Suggest stabilizing cleansers that support the skin barrier while extensively getting rid of pollutants. Encourage customers to prevent severe stripping items, which can set off more oil manufacturing and sensitivity.


Of course, SPF is non-negotiable year-round, yet spring is an ideal time to increase down on sun defense. With longer daylight hours and even more time spent outside, a broad-spectrum SPF needs to belong to every morning regimen. Deal clients alternatives that feel light-weight and breathable to support day-to-day wear.

Addressing Seasonal Skin Stressors Head-On


Spring isn't simply sunlight and roses. It additionally brings seasonal allergic reactions, boosted pollen, and a greater chance of irritability or flare-ups. As a proactive skincare professional, prepare for these issues and construct preventative measures into your customer procedures.


Look for indicators of sensitized skin, such as inflammation, dry skin, or itching, particularly in clients vulnerable to seasonal allergic reactions. Focus on relaxing ingredients and obstacle support. Suggest lifestyle adjustments, such as cleaning the face after being outdoors, to reduce allergen direct exposure.


Hydration remains crucial, also as humidity surges. Yet hydration doesn't need to imply heavy. Urge using hydrating hazes, serums with hyaluronic acid, and light-weight creams that absorb promptly while keeping the skin plump.

Making Protocol Adjustments Personal


No 2 skins are alike, which suggests no two springtime procedures ought to equal. Use this seasonal change as a possibility to reconnect with customers on an individual degree. Offer springtime skin check-ins or mini-consultations to evaluate progress and make thoughtful modifications.


Listen to their worries. Are they really feeling oily? Bursting out more? Observing coloring or inflammation? Use their feedback to lead your changes. You might recommend including components like niacinamide for calming, vitamin C for lightening up, or light-weight anti-oxidants to sustain skin throughout boosted sunlight direct exposure.
